Advertisement

STM32抢答器制作资源.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
该资源包包含STM32微控制器设计实现的抢答器系统相关资料,包括电路图、代码示例及详细文档说明。适合电子工程爱好者和技术学习者参考使用。 基于嵌入式STM32单片机的4路抢答器系统设计主要分为硬件设备和软件控制两大部分。外部硬件使用STM32单片机作为控制中心,并配备四个按键作为抢答输入,当开始抢答后,成功者的编号会在屏幕上显示出来。资料包含原理图、PCB文件以及程序源码。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• STM32.zip
    优质
    该资源包包含STM32微控制器设计实现的抢答器系统相关资料,包括电路图、代码示例及详细文档说明。适合电子工程爱好者和技术学习者参考使用。 基于嵌入式STM32单片机的4路抢答器系统设计主要分为硬件设备和软件控制两大部分。外部硬件使用STM32单片机作为控制中心,并配备四个按键作为抢答输入,当开始抢答后,成功者的编号会在屏幕上显示出来。资料包含原理图、PCB文件以及程序源码。
  • STM32代码.zip
    优质
    这是一个包含STM32微控制器编程实现的抢答器系统的源代码压缩包。代码内含详细注释,适用于嵌入式系统课程学习或实际项目开发参考。 基于STM32的抢答器具有五路抢答功能,并且配备了裁判加分减分的功能。此外,在选手完成抢答后还支持计时功能。该设备使用LCD1602进行显示,并设有专门的一键抢答和一键重新抢答按钮。
  • 基于STM32微控设计
    优质
    本项目介绍了一种基于STM32微控制器的高效能抢答器设计方案,集成了先进的硬件和软件技术,适用于各类竞赛场合。 本设计包括STM32F103C8T6单片机电路、LCD1602液晶显示电路及5路按键电路。系统上电后,第一次按下任意一个按键时,对应的标号会在LCD1602液晶屏上显示:第一个按键先被按下,则屏幕会显示出数字“1”;第二个键则为“2”,以此类推直到第五个按钮对应的是数字“5”。每次仅能显示一位数。除非系统重新启动或按下复位键,否则不会开始新的抢答环节。 资料包括: - 程序源码 - 电路图 - 开题报告 - 答辩技巧指导 - 参考论文 - 系统框图 - 流程图 - 所用芯片的技术文档 - 元器件清单及说明 - PCB焊接指南和常见问题解答
  • .zip
    优质
    《答题抢答器》是一款集成了现代化竞赛需求的设计软件包,适用于各类知识竞赛和学术讨论会。通过简洁直观的操作界面,用户可以轻松创建并管理个人化的问答环节,增加互动性和趣味性。此工具支持快速准确的计分机制及时间限制设定,确保比赛公平公正地进行。 基于Multisim的四人抢答器仿真文件下载后可以直接打开使用。
  • 八路的8255方法
    优质
    本项目详细介绍如何使用8255芯片构建一个高效的八路抢答器系统,适合电子工程爱好者及学生学习和实践。 8255制作的八路抢答器包含有源代码和具体的连接图。
  • 9路与设计
    优质
    本项目详细介绍了一个基于Arduino平台的九路抢答器的设计与实现过程,包括硬件电路搭建、软件编程及系统测试等环节。 在每次抢答前,主持人首先按下复位键将抢答器上的“抢答号”数显清零至0。接着,主持人开始念出答题内容,在说完后喊一声“抢答”。这时参赛者会迅速按动自己号码对应的抢答按钮。一旦任何一位或所有参赛者的按键被触发并释放,扬声器就会发出双音频警示声音,并且显示屏上会出现最先按下键的“抢答号”。 当显示了具体的抢答编号之后,主持人随即喊出:“X号”,同时启动(按动)答题限时的倒计时按钮。此时可以看到倒计时装置从0开始逐秒递减至9、8、7……直至1再回到0,并且在最后数显为0后保持稳定不变状态,直到下一次抢答环节主持人再次按下“倒计时”键为止。 该系统主要由以下元器件构成:LM317(用于调整电压到9V),LM7809,CD4069, CD4011, CD40110, NE555, CD4068和CD4511。此外还有两片数码管、IN4148二极管以及若干电阻与电容等元件共同协作完成功能。
  • 三路与设计
    优质
    本项目详细介绍了一个三路抢答器的设计与制作过程。通过电路设计、硬件搭建和软件编程实现,在各类竞赛或活动中能有效管理参与者抢答顺序。 智力竞赛是一种生动活泼的教育形式与方法,通过抢答和必答题的形式能够激发参赛者及观众的兴趣,并在短时间内增加科学知识和生活常识。实际进行智力竞赛时,尤其是在抢答环节中,通常有四个参赛队,每个队伍面前都有一个独立的抢答按钮。当主持人宣布可以开始抢答后,各小组才能使用这些按钮。 首先按下按钮的团队将通过声音和灯光指示显示出来,并且屏幕上会显示出该组编号;此时其他未成功抢先回答问题的小组无效作答。如果在规定的时间内没有队伍完成有效答题,则此次抢答视为无效。
  • 16路文件.zip
    优质
    本压缩包包含一个16路抢答器的设计源文件,适用于电子竞赛和教学用途,内含电路图、PCB布局及程序代码等资源。 16路抢答器的设计包括使用Keil4编程与Proteus 7.7仿真,并附带设计报告。主要功能分为三个阶段: 第一阶段:在比赛未开始前,数码管显示“FFFF”,LED灯亮红灯。此阶段有两个功能: - 违规显示:如果有人在此期间按下抢答键,则数码管会显示出违规选手的号码和FF,同时扬声器响一秒。 - 时间调整:仅当系统处于初始状态且没有违规行为时,可以使用按键来增加或减少答题时间(40至60秒)与抢答时间(30至60秒)。按一次对应的时间加一。此外还有一个复位键可将所有设置恢复到初始状态。 第二阶段:进入比赛准备阶段后,数码管显示倒计时,LED灯亮黄灯,并且扬声器响一秒作为提示音。当倒计时结束时,扬声器会连续发出五次提醒声音。如果没有人抢答,则数码管重新回到“FFFF”,按开始键可以重置;如果有选手成功抢答则进入答题阶段。 第三阶段:一旦有参赛者按下抢答按钮后,系统将切换至答题模式,在此期间数码管显示倒计时时间,LED灯亮绿光,并且扬声器响一秒。当倒计时期满时,扬声器同样会发出五次间隔的提醒音以结束比赛。
  • 八路_qiangdaqi.rar_ qiangdaqi_51 单片机 __
    优质
    本资源包含一个基于51单片机设计的八路抢答器项目文件,包括电路图和源代码。适用于电子竞赛或课堂教学,帮助学习者掌握抢答器的工作原理及实现方法。 亲测:基于51单片机的八路抢答器功能强大,包含查询、设置、抢答和答题等多项实用功能,与其他同类源码相比更为全面。
  • 4路.zip
    优质
    4路抢答器是一款专为竞赛设计的电子设备软件包,支持四位参与者同时竞答,具备快速响应、准确判断功能,适用于各类知识问答和团队竞赛场合。 【4路抢答器】是一种常见的电子设备,在竞赛或活动中用于处理抢答环节。它能同时连接四位参赛者的按钮,并确保在主持人宣布开始后首位按下按钮的选手被准确识别,以保证比赛过程中的公正性。 设计一个4路抢答器主要需要掌握以下技术知识点: 1. **数字电路**:该设备的核心是使用各种基本逻辑门(如与非门、或非门和缓冲器)来处理并传输信号。通过组合这些元件可以实现比较及选择功能,以确保正确的响应。 2. **单片机**:现代抢答器通常采用微控制器作为核心处理器,例如8051系列、AVR系列或者ARM系列产品,它们集成了CPU、内存和IO接口等组件,并能处理输入信号控制输出指示。编程语言常用C或汇编来编写程序实现抢答逻辑。 3. **输入/输出接口**:每个参赛通道都需要一个独立的输入端口以检测按钮状态变化;同时还需要相应的输出设备(如LED灯、蜂鸣器或者LCD屏幕)显示获胜者信息。 4. **中断系统**:在多路抢答中,单片机必须能够快速响应任一通道上的信号改变。这需要通过设置适当的硬件和软件机制来实现高效的中断处理能力。 5. **计时功能**:为了保证公平性,设备通常会配备一个精确的计时器模块用于记录选手们的反应时间,并且可以根据比赛规则设定相应的启动与停止条件。 6. **电路设计**:在进行抢答器硬件设计过程中,必须考虑电磁兼容性和按钮防抖动处理等问题以确保信号稳定传输和避免误判情况发生。 7. **软件开发**:除了核心的抢答逻辑之外,还需要编写用户交互界面相关代码来支持参数设置、状态显示以及比赛结果记录等功能。图形化用户界面的设计也可能成为重要的一部分内容。 8. **安全性和可靠性**:抢答器需要确保操作的安全性,并且能够在各种环境下长期稳定运行而不会出现故障或者损坏等问题。 9. **电源管理**:考虑到便携性的需求,设备往往由电池供电工作;因此在设计时需要注意节约电量同时保证良好的电压稳定性以支持持续使用。 10. **调试与测试**:开发完成后必须经过全面的性能验证和功能检查来确保所有组件协调一致并且能够满足实际应用中的要求。 总之,4路抢答器的设计融合了硬件、软件以及系统集成等多个方面的专业知识和技术。通过深入理解上述各个要点可以更好地掌握如何构建这样一款实用且高效的电子设备。